Description
What It Is:
This is an educational worksheet focused on identifying pronoun shifts. It contains a short paragraph at the beginning that requires students to underline the pronoun shifts. Following this are seven sentences where students must identify and correct the pronoun shift by writing the correct pronoun on the line provided. The worksheet also includes an illustration of an umbrella and rain clouds.
Grade Level Suitability:
This worksheet is suitable for grades 5-7. The complexity of identifying pronoun shifts requires a solid understanding of grammar and pronoun usage, typically developed in these grade levels.
Why Use It:
This worksheet helps students develop their understanding of pronoun agreement and consistency within sentences and paragraphs. It reinforces the importance of using pronouns correctly to maintain clarity and avoid confusion in writing.
How to Use It:
Students should first read the instructions carefully. Then, they should read each sentence or paragraph and identify any instances where the pronoun usage shifts inappropriately. In the initial paragraph, they should underline the incorrect pronouns. In the following sentences, they should write the correct pronoun on the provided line.
Target Users:
This worksheet is designed for students in upper elementary and middle school who are learning about pronoun agreement and pronoun shifts. It can also be used as a review activity for students who need additional practice with grammar concepts.
